Official record
Development description
- Planning permission for development at the molesworth building, 10-11 molesworth street, dublin
- The development will consist of the erection of signage on the external elevations of the building comprising: individually mounted back halo illuminated steel letters over the building entrance facing molesworth street; individually mounted steel letters and company sign within a steel frame (1 metre square) at ground floor on the south frederick street elevation; and individually mounted steel letters and company sign within a steel frame (0.8 metres square) at ground floor on the building recess adjacent to the building entrance facing south frederick street
